    Huawei comes up with an unusual solution for Mate 80’s cooling fan

    We’ve seen a bunch of mainstream smartphones with cooling fans so far, most recently the Oppo K13 Turbo and K13 Turbo Pro, and it seems like Huawei wants to outfit the upcoming Mate 80 with such a contraption as well.

    But the Chinese company has gone a different route compared to its competitors, by integrating the fan into the phone’s large circular camera island – in the lower half of it, specifically.

    The air intake outlet thus sits on the side of the camera island, not on the side of the phone itself. It definitely sounds like a very interesting design, and it’s one that Huawei is currently working on perfecting.

    The Mate 80 Pro will have water resistance too, despite the fan, as the fan itself has a waterproof structure. The fan will be small and very high-speed, with tiny miniaturized fins.

    We’re very curious to see this in action, so we hope Huawei does manage to overcome all of the engineering challenges it entails and actually bring it to market in the Mate 80 later this year.
